ADIDAS ORIGINALS “LEGACY OF CRAFTSMANSHIP” CELEBRATES DESIGNER MARKUS THALER

In a short film following the life and expressing the philosophies of Markus Thaler, one of the original designers and disciple of Adi Dassler himself, adidas Originals’ The “Legacy of Craftsmanship” introduces a new bloodline of premium designers while giving fans an look behind the scenes to a few custom pairs of sneakers for adidas partners.

The designer developed some of the brand’s most cherished designs and you can see why when you listen to the passion behind the man, who is soon to retire after some 40 years in the game.

Under the guidance of Markus Thaler, adidas Originals has always encouraged its designers to learn all aspects of footwear manufacture, from traditional methods of shoemaking to the technical innovations that allow them to push boundaries.

KILLIAN MARTIN STATIONPARK - ABANDONED STATION SKATE VIDEO

Killian Martin grew up with a passion for surfing that could not be realized, with no ocean within six hours. With the absence of the means to realize this passion, the now world-famous skater combined two of his other intense skills in gymnastics and skateboarding to create a unique and irreplaceable style. The professional athlete is a skate video director’s dream come true, and he has created many well-done and artsy videos, including his recent visit to an abandoned waterpark outside Los Angeles that took the internet by storm thanks to the help of filmmaker Brett Novak.

This time the skater visits another abandoned skating playground in the historic Park Station, and director Juan Rayos was there to capture all of the action in a beautifully-edited style.

AARON ROSE: PORTRAIT OF THE ARTIST AS A BEAUTIFUL LOSER

Aaron Rose sits down with Gestalten.tv for an interview encompassing his many views on art, anarchy, and the art world as a whole, discussing some of the more diverse opinions that have defined his shotgun effect on the world of creativity. Having worked in street art, curation, film, photography, writing, music, and many other fields, Rose is addicted to creation. The artist is also addicted to talking art with friends and strangers, as anyone who has run into him at openings and art receptions around the city and the world can tell you.

One of the more inspiring artists to come out of the street art movement, the man who introduced Shepard Fairey, Barry McGee, and Harmony Korine is a blast to hear every time he speaks on his passions.
